What is shape in the 7 elements of art?

Shape- Shape is the result of closed lines, they are two dimensional and flat. Shapes can be geometric, such as squares or triangles or they can be organic and not have defined parameters and are more curved and abstract. Shapes in art can be used to control how the viewer perceives a piece.

What is the example of shape in elements of art?

Examples include: circle, triangle, square, and trapezoid. Many man-made objects are made in the form of geometric shapes. Cell phones, buildings, and wheels are all examples of man-made forms that resemble geometric shapes.

What is visual texture in art?

Visual/Implied Texture. •Visual texture is the illusion/representation of. physical texture. It is created by the. manipulation of light and shadow to mimic the visual experience of physical texture.
